ADM1020AR-REEL Description
Overview of Analog Devices ADM1020AR-REEL

The Analog Devices ADM1020AR-REEL is a high-precision temperature sensor and voltage monitor designed for various applications, including thermal management, power supply monitoring, and system health monitoring. This device is particularly useful in environments where accurate temperature readings and voltage levels are critical for system performance and reliability. The ADM1020AR-REEL combines ease of use with advanced features, making it suitable for a wide range of electronic applications.

Key Specifications

- Type: Digital Temperature Sensor and Voltage Monitor
- Package Type: 8-Pin SOIC (Small Outline Integrated Circuit)
- Temperature Measurement Range: -55°C to +125°C
- Temperature Resolution: 0.5°C
- Voltage Measurement Range: 0V to 5V
- Supply Voltage: 3.0V to 5.5V
- Interface: I2C-compatible serial interface
- Accuracy: ±1°C (typical) at 25°C
- Power Consumption: 1.5 mA (typical)
- Operating Temperature Range: -40°C to +85°C

Functional Features

The ADM1020AR-REEL includes several advanced features that enhance its functionality in temperature and voltage monitoring applications:

- High Precision: The device provides accurate temperature measurements with a typical accuracy of ±1°C at 25°C, making it suitable for applications requiring precise thermal management.
- Digital Output: The ADM1020AR-REEL features a digital output via an I2C-compatible interface, allowing for easy integration with microcontrollers and digital systems. This digital communication simplifies data retrieval and processing.
- Multiple Voltage Monitoring: The device can monitor multiple voltage levels, providing critical information for power supply management and system health monitoring. This feature is essential for ensuring that components operate within their specified voltage ranges.
- Programmable Alert Function: The ADM1020AR-REEL includes programmable alert thresholds for both temperature and voltage, enabling proactive monitoring and system protection. This feature allows designers to set specific limits and receive alerts when conditions exceed predefined thresholds.

Electrical Characteristics

The ADM1020AR-REEL operates with a supply voltage range of 3.0V to 5.5V, making it compatible with various power sources commonly used in electronic systems. The power consumption of approximately 1.5 mA ensures that the device can be used in battery-powered applications without significantly impacting overall system power budgets. The operating temperature range of -40°C to +85°C allows for reliable performance in harsh environments.
